Book excerpt: Tres ensayos sobre teor�a sexual es una obra de 1905 de Sigmund Freud que avanza su teor�a de la sexualidad, en particular, su relaci�n con la infancia. Junto con la Interpretaci�n de los sue�os, estos ensayos son una de las contribuciones m�s trascendentales y originales de Freud al conocimiento humano.En resumen, Freud argument� que "la perversi�n" estaba presente incluso entre las personas sanas, y que el camino hacia una actitud sexual madura y normal comenzaba no en la pubertad sino en la temprana infancia.Observando a los ni�os, Freud afirm� encontrar una serie de pr�cticas que parec�an inofensivas pero que eran realmente formas de actividad sexual. Freud tambi�n procur� unir su teor�a del inconsciente propuesta en la Interpretaci�n de los sue�os (1899) y su trabajo sobre la histeria postulando a la sexualidad como la fuerza pulsional tanto en la neurosis (por medio de la represi�n) como en la perversi�n (por medio de la operatoria de la desmentida de la castraci�n). Tambi�n inclu�a los conceptos de envidia del pene, complejo de castraci�n y complejo de Edipo.

Book excerpt: Freud's Mexican disciples, Mexican books, Mexican antiquities, and Mexican dreams. Freud's Mexico is a completely unexpected contribution to Freud studies. Here, Rubén Gallo reveals Freud's previously undisclosed connections to a culture and a psychoanalytic tradition not often associated with him. This book bears detailed testimony to Freud's relationship to a country he never set foot in, but inhabited imaginatively on many levels. In the Mexico of the 1920s and 1930s, Freud made an impact not only among psychiatrists but also in literary, artistic, and political circles. Gallo writes about a “motley crew” of Freud's readers who devised some of the most original, elaborate, and influential applications of psychoanalytic theory anywhere in the world. After describing Mexico's Freud, Gallo offers an imaginative reconstruction of Freud's Mexico: Freud owned a treatise on criminal law by a Mexican judge who put defendants—including Trotsky's assassin—on the psychoanalyst's couch; he acquired Mexican pieces as part of his celebrated collection of antiquities; he recorded dreams of a Mexico that was fraught with danger; and he belonged to a secret society that conducted its affairs in Spanish.

Book excerpt: In 1926, as a young man of 28 with a growing reputation as an oral poet, Federico Garcia Lorca (1898-1936) toyed with the idea of proving his worth in writing by bringing out a boxed set of three volumes of his verse. Because the Suites , Canciones , and the Poema del cante jondo eventually came out singly (in the case of the Suites , posthumously), readers have not always realised that they formed a single body of work -- one which, Lorca himself was surprised to note, has 'una rarisima unidad', an odd unity of aims and accomplishment. This is poetry which takes up the question of desire in progressively depersonalizing ways, and shows modernism coming into being. Through renunciation, by cutting away the personal and the taboo, Lorca created a poetry that, like no other in Europe, stood between the avant-garde and oral traditions, making their contradictions his truth.
